Yes, you can junk a car without tires! A car still has valuable parts without wheels, like the engine, transmission, and body. To sell it, contact a local junkyard or junk car removal service. They’ll tow away your tireless car, salvage its usable parts, and recycle what’s left.

Scrap Metal Market Trends

The prices of metal can go up and down a lot. Steel used to be worth around $800 per ton, but now it’s around $650. Copper is worth about $4 per pound, and aluminum is around $1.20.

It’s important to stay updated on these trends to know when to sell your old metal car for the most money.

Cost Implications

When it comes to towing a rusty car, costs can vary. A standard tow is around $50-$150, depending on the distance. When your car is stuck, you can need winching for an extra $50-$100.

For trickier cases, a flatbed tow can cost $150-$200.

Documentation Needed

When you want to junk a car without tires, you’ll usually need its title or proof of ownership. You’ll also need a valid ID.

Different states can have additional paperwork requirements. So, it’s important to check local rules or ask a local junkyard about the exact documents you’ll need.
